Sommario/riassunto |
|
Imagining Sex examines a variety of material from seventeenth-century England to argue that, unlike today, pornography was not a discrete genre, nor was it usually subject to suppression. Analysing representations of sex and eroticism in historical context, the book explores contemporary thinking on these issues and wider cultural concerns. - ;Imagining Sex is a study of pornographic writing in seventeenth-century England. Sommario/riassunto |
|
"After decades of missed opportunities, the door to a sustainable future has closed, and the future we face now is one in which today's industrial civilization unravels in the face of uncontrolled climate change and resource depletion. The questions we need to ask now focus on what comes next. This book provides a hard but hopeful look at the answer."-- |

Sommario/riassunto |
|
This field-tested resource outlines effective approaches for improving student learning, proficiency, and achievement at all levels through learning-focused priorities, results-driven practices, and high academic expectations. |
